在信息化时代,信息登记已成为我们日常生活中不可或缺的一部分。无论是办理各类手续,还是参与各类活动,都需要进行信息登记。然而,繁琐的登记流程往往让人头疼。今天,就让我来为大家介绍一种神奇的方法——一键提交,轻松搞定信息登记。
一键提交的优势
一键提交,顾名思义,就是通过一个简单的操作就能完成信息登记。相比传统方式,它具有以下优势:
- 提高效率:一键提交可以节省大量时间,让用户不再为繁琐的登记流程而烦恼。
- 简化操作:用户无需记住复杂的填写规则,只需按照提示进行操作即可。
- 减少错误:一键提交系统通常具有自动校验功能,有效降低错误率。
- 保护隐私:一键提交系统可以采用加密技术,确保用户信息安全。
一键提交的实现方式
一键提交的实现方式多种多样,以下列举几种常见的实现方法:
1. 智能扫码
用户只需扫描二维码,即可进入信息登记页面。系统会自动识别用户身份,并填充相关信息,用户只需确认即可完成登记。
import qrcode
# 生成二维码
def create_qrcode(data):
qr = qrcode.QRCode(
version=1,
error_correction=qrcode.constants.ERROR_CORRECT_L,
box_size=10,
border=4,
)
qr.add_data(data)
qr.make(fit=True)
img = qr.make_image(fill_color="black", back_color="white")
img.show()
# 测试
create_qrcode("user_id:123456")
2. 语音输入
用户可以通过语音输入信息,系统将自动识别语音内容并完成信息登记。
import speech_recognition as sr
# 语音识别
def recognize_speech():
recognizer = sr.Recognizer()
with sr.Microphone() as source:
print("请开始说话...")
audio = recognizer.listen(source)
try:
text = recognizer.recognize_google(audio, language='zh-CN')
print("识别结果:", text)
except sr.UnknownValueError:
print("无法识别")
except sr.RequestError:
print("无法请求结果")
# 测试
recognize_speech()
3. 人工智能助手
用户可以通过与人工智能助手进行对话,完成信息登记。
class Assistant:
def __init__(self):
self.user_id = None
def ask_user_id(self):
self.user_id = input("请输入您的用户ID:")
return self.user_id
def register_info(self):
print("您好,以下是您的信息:")
print("用户ID:", self.user_id)
# ...此处添加其他信息登记逻辑
# 测试
assistant = Assistant()
assistant.ask_user_id()
assistant.register_info()
一键提交的应用场景
一键提交广泛应用于以下场景:
- 政务服务平台:简化办事流程,提高办事效率。
- 企业内部管理系统:方便员工信息登记,降低管理成本。
- 活动报名:快速收集报名信息,提高活动组织效率。
- 电商平台:简化购物流程,提高用户体验。
总之,一键提交为我们的生活带来了诸多便利。随着科技的不断发展,相信未来会有更多一键提交的应用场景出现,让我们的生活更加美好。
